Water damage insurance claims are an important side of home possession, affecting numerous property homeowners every year. Understanding the intricacies of filing these claims can make a big distinction within the recovery process. Homeowners usually encounter water damage as a outcome of numerous causes, corresponding to pure disasters, plumbing failures, and even human errors. Regardless of the source, the aftermath typically leads to vital financial stress and emotional turmoil.


When water damage occurs, the immediate response is crucial. Homeowners must act swiftly to reduce further damage. This may contain shutting off the water provide, using pumps to remove excess water, or calling in professionals. However, amidst this chaos, it's essential to keep in thoughts that documenting the damage is equally important. Taking photographs, making notes of affected areas, and gathering any relevant receipts can support the claims process significantly.


Upon noticing water damage, owners should promptly contact their insurance supplier. This initial notification is essential, as many insurance policies have particular cut-off dates for reporting damage. Failing to report water damage within the required timeframe could lead to problems, together with denial of the claim. Clear communication with the insurance coverage company units a solid basis for the complete claims process.


Understanding the specific terms and protection limits of one’s insurance coverage coverage is key in navigating water damage insurance claims. Policies can vary considerably in what they cover. For instance, some might cover damage attributable to sudden, unintended water launch, similar to a burst pipe, while others could not cowl damage ensuing from negligence or upkeep issues. Homeowners should familiarize themselves with the details of their policy earlier than making any claims.

In many instances, the sort of water that caused the damage influences the claims process. There are typically three classes of water damage: clean water, grey water, and black water. Clean water refers to water from a clear source, whereas gray water accommodates some contaminants. Black water consists of sewage and poses higher well being risks. Insurance insurance policies might have totally different stipulations depending on the water sort, affecting payout amounts and coverage.


Once the claim is filed, an insurance coverage adjuster is typically assigned to gauge the damage. This skilled assesses the situation, estimates repair prices, and determines if the claim is valid per the insured's coverage. It is important for owners to be prepared for this visit by providing documentation and being available for questions. Clear and open communication with the adjuster can facilitate a easy evaluation process.


Homeowners typically feel overwhelmed in the course of the claims process, especially when coping with the emotional fallout of water damage. Keeping organized information can help alleviate some stress. Maintaining a file with all communication associated to the claim, images, and repair estimates can provide a comprehensive overview. This organized approach not only assists in the claims process but also prepares homeowners for any potential disputes.

In many instances, water damage can result in the growth of mold, including another layer of complexity to claims. Mold can develop shortly when conditions are proper, typically within 24 to forty eight hours of water exposure. Many insurance policies have specific exclusions concerning mold damage, so understanding these terms is important. Homeowners may have separate protection to protect in opposition to potential mold infestations.


Following the insurance adjuster's assessment, homeowners might obtain a suggestion from the insurance coverage company. This supply usually represents the amount the insurer is prepared to pay for the damage incurred. However, owners may discover that this offer isn't consistent with their expectations or the actual costs of repair. In such cases, negotiating with the insurance coverage company becomes important.

Some householders find it beneficial to hire a public adjuster, especially when dealing with substantial claims. Public adjusters are licensed professionals who work for the policyholder, not the insurance coverage company. They assess damage, doc losses, and negotiate with the insurer on behalf of the home-owner. While hiring a public adjuster involves a payment, many householders discover the funding worthwhile in securing a better settlement.
